And it is this. Know your league, not just your roster, okay? Know your league, not just your roster. And this can be explained in any number of ways, and you guys can jump in and share what you think. But the way that your league mates play fantasy football, the way that they sign players, the way that they think about players, the way they think about your team, the way they draft, all of that has an impact on the way you play.

21:57 ↗

and the way your team performs and what you can do during the draft. And that may seem like, well, duh. But a lot of players don't play that way. A lot of players play with a cheat sheet out in front of them. I'm on an island. You're on an island. You're in a vacuum. You've got your cheat sheet and your blinders on. And I'm going to tell you from years and years of playing, my biggest wins, trade-wise, strategy-wise, have often come from knowing the people in my league.

One of the ways you need to think about your league and not just your roster is filtering the advice that you get, even from a show like this. Your league may have unique rules. That means unique ranking. Scoring system, for example, if you're not aware of the Scotty Fishbowl.

23:45 ↗

It's this huge mega tournament that Scott Fish shout out to my man Scott Fish who puts this thing on every single year. It's massive. Epic. It's like 500 players or something in it. But every year he changes up the scoring system. For example, this year, there is no PPR for wide receivers or running backs. However, there's PPR for tight ends. And then there's a point per first down.

24:11 ↗

So this radically changes things. And we frequently get questions of people saying, well, if it's, we have a PPR league, but I'm also getting, you know, a half point per carry. You're like, well, holy crap, man. It changes some stuff. Yeah, that changes everything. You're your, David Johnson's, the level, they go even further into the stratosphere.
